Output 283c16cc1fec59b956570a9ed3f23ecec5bca87702194993ac9cf38bff20709e:20

value
254109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8193bfef49d46fa809e732ba7af5691344f20edb OP_EQUAL
address
3DWA6837DuszWkusJ5UBrpJ64aUGkYJvWc
transaction
283c16cc1fec59b956570a9ed3f23ecec5bca87702194993ac9cf38bff20709e
spent
true